2016-08-12 6 views
3

일부 git 커밋은 TFS 서버에서 사라졌습니다. 우리가 확인한는 SQL DB에 TFS GIT 저장 commmits으로작성된 데이터가 없습니다 : 저장 공간이 부족합니다 - Git on TFS 2015

Failed to mmap. No data written: Not enough storage is available

디스크 & DB 공간 :

는 개발자는 다음과 같은 메시지가 있었다. 모든 것은 괜찮습니다.

리포 기록은 다시 작성되지 않았습니다.

우리는 설명을 찾고 있습니다. 누구나 일어날 수있는 일과 다시 일어날 수없는 일에 대해 어떻게 생각하고 있습니까?

+0

https://github.com/git-tfs/git-tfs/issues/621 – CodeCaster

+0

어떻게하면 libgit2sharp의 버전을 확인할 수 있습니까? –

+0

이것은 대화 상자에 표시되는 내용에도 불구하고 _Visual Studio_ 문제인데도 클라이언트의 문제입니다. 어떤 버전의 VS를 사용하고 있습니까? –

답변

1

죄송합니다. 이것은 Visual Studio에서 사용되는 Windows 용 libgit2의 32 비트 버전 버그이며 패키지 파일을 메모리 매핑하는 방법입니다. libgit2 최신 버전에서는이 문제가 largelybeen fixed이지만,이 저장소를 현재 버전의 Visual Studio로 푸시는데 도움이되지는 않습니다.

이 변경 사항을 명령 줄과 함께 푸시해야합니다.

+0

다음 Visual Studio 업데이트에서 수정 될 예정인지 알고 계십니까? –

+0

@StevenMuhr 죄송합니다. Visual Studio에서 더 이상 작업하지 않습니다. –

+0

@StevenMuhr 그러나 VS 15로 고정해야합니다 (혼란스럽게도 2015 년 이후 VS의 다음 버전). –

관련 문제